配置Redis集群全局属性配置优化(redis集群全局属性)

2023-05-07 18:00:53 集群 属性 全局

Redis集群是由多个Redis实例组成的系统,使用Redis集群可以在大规模的数据处理、高性能的场景下满足性能需求,但是,如何配置Redis集群和全局属性优化才能让Redis集群更快更好的工作呢?本文主要介绍配置Redis集群和全局属性优化的方法。

配置Redis集群以实现性能高效的数据存储,需要首先对Redis集群环境进行调优,本文将重点介绍全局属性配置。

1、主从复制:在Redis集群中,可以从一个或多个Redis副本库向主库进行复制,从而实现数据一致性。

2、内存分配:分配Redis所用的内存,具体的分配方法取决于配置Redis集群的大小,正确的内存分配对实现Redis性能调优很重要。

3、保存策略:需要根据系统的实际情况来配置Redis的保存策略,即在Redis停止时将脏数据保存到硬盘中,以保证数据的完整性和Redis集群的可用性。

4、数据过期:合理的设置Redis中数据的过期时间,可以帮助系统回收空间,减少系统不必要的开销,优化Redis性能。

5、Redis掩码:Redis使用特定掩码机制来支持模糊查找,合理的掩码运算有助于减少 Redis 的查询次数,从而提高数据访问性能。

以上就是Redis集群全局属性调优的方法,如果Redis集群环境正确配置,恰当调优,那么Redis集群就可以更加快速,更加有效地工作。下面我们以样例为例写一段代码,来展示配置Redis集群和定义全局属性优化的方法:

//全局属性调优

//1、主从复制

//for instance in Redis cluster:

redisCluster.replicate_master_slave(127.0.0.1:6379, 127.0.0.2:6379)

//2、设置内存空间

redisCluster.set_max_memory(1G)

//3、数据过期的设置

redisCluster.data_expire_time(24h)

//4、掩码设置

redisCluster.mask(‘*’)

以上就是Redis集群的配置和全局属性优化的方法,通过合理的配置和调优,Redis集群的性能得到有效提升,为数据的高性能存取提供支持。

相关文章